Homeowners, however, require simplified guidance regarding building envelope The tests to date have shown that in attics with R-19 insulation, radiant barriers can reduce summer ceiling heat gains by about 16 to 42 percent compared to an attic with the same insulation level and no radiant barrier. Sep 18, 2024 · Unlike fiberglass or cellulose insulation, radiant barriers do little to prevent the conduction of heat or cold through the air and have no R-value. Roof mounted radiant barriers may increase shingle temperatures by 2 to 10oF, while radiant barriers on the attic floor may cause smaller increases of 2F or less.
